Hooks and filters fired · 7
7 hooks fire while _print_emoji_detection_script() runs, in this order:
- apply_filters( emoji_url )filterline 6032 (+9 into the body)
Filters the URL where emoji png images are hosted.
- apply_filters( emoji_ext )filterline 6041 (+18 into the body)
Filters the extension of the emoji png files.
- apply_filters( emoji_svg_url )filterline 6050 (+27 into the body)
Filters the URL where emoji SVG images are hosted.
- apply_filters( emoji_svg_ext )filterline 6059 (+36 into the body)
Filters the extension of the emoji SVG files.
- apply_filters( script_loader_src )filterline 6067 (+44 into the body)
Filters the script loader source.
- apply_filters( script_loader_src )filterline 6069 (+46 into the body)
Filters the script loader source.
- apply_filters( script_loader_src )filterline 6074 (+51 into the body)
Filters the script loader source.

Source code
function _print_emoji_detection_script() { $settings = array( /** * Filters the URL where emoji png images are hosted. * * @since 4.2.0 * * @param string $url The emoji base URL for png images. */ 'baseUrl' => apply_filters( 'emoji_url', 'https://s.w.org/images/core/emoji/17.0.2/72x72/' ), /** * Filters the extension of the emoji png files. * * @since 4.2.0 * * @param string $extension The emoji extension for png files. Default .png. */ 'ext' => apply_filters( 'emoji_ext', '.png' ), /** * Filters the URL where emoji SVG images are hosted. * * @since 4.6.0 * * @param string $url The emoji base URL for svg images. */ 'svgUrl' => apply_filters( 'emoji_svg_url', 'https://s.w.org/images/core/emoji/17.0.2/svg/' ), /** * Filters the extension of the emoji SVG files. * * @since 4.6.0 * * @param string $extension The emoji extension for svg files. Default .svg. */ 'svgExt' => apply_filters( 'emoji_svg_ext', '.svg' ), ); $version = 'ver=' . get_bloginfo( 'version' ); if ( SCRIPT_DEBUG ) { $settings['source'] = array( /** This filter is documented in wp-includes/class-wp-scripts.php */ 'wpemoji' => apply_filters( 'script_loader_src', includes_url( "js/wp-emoji.js?$version" ), 'wpemoji' ), /** This filter is documented in wp-includes/class-wp-scripts.php */ 'twemoji' => apply_filters( 'script_loader_src', includes_url( "js/twemoji.js?$version" ), 'twemoji' ), ); } else { $settings['source'] = array( /** This filter is documented in wp-includes/class-wp-scripts.php */ 'concatemoji' => apply_filters( 'script_loader_src', includes_url( "js/wp-emoji-release.min.js?$version" ), 'concatemoji' ), ); } wp_print_inline_script_tag( wp_json_encode( $settings, JSON_HEX_TAG | JSON_UNESCAPED_SLASHES ), array( 'id' => 'wp-emoji-settings', 'type' => 'application/json', ) ); $emoji_loader_script_path = '/js/wp-emoji-loader' . wp_scripts_get_suffix() . '.js'; wp_print_inline_script_tag( rtrim( file_get_contents( ABSPATH . WPINC . $emoji_loader_script_path ) ) . "\n" . '//# sourceURL=' . esc_url_raw( includes_url( $emoji_loader_script_path ) ), array( 'type' => 'module', ) );}Changelog
